    VIBRATION TESTS METHOD AND SEVERITIES FOR MUNITIONS CARRIED IN TRACKED VEHICLES - AOP-34

    Aim is to register national acceptance of AOP-34 test method and its associated severities for assessment of the effects of vibration on safety and suitability for service for munitions carried in tracked vehicles for use by NATO nations.
